Profile Brief:
Dr. Ranganatha is a highly skilled surgeon with expertise in Gastrointestinal surgery, Hepatopancreaticobiliary (HPB) surgery, and Liver Transplantation. He has been trained at prestigious institutions in India and has assisted in over 200 liver transplant surgeries. He completed his HPB and liver transplant fellowship at Max Hospital, Saket, New Delhi, and continues to contribute to the field through research and clinical practice.
